My Buying Guides on ‘Charger For Calculator Ti-84 Plus Ce’
When I first needed a charger for my TI-84 Plus CE calculator, I realized there are quite a few options out there. To help you avoid the confusion I faced, I’m sharing my personal experience and what I learned while choosing the right charger for this calculator.
1. Understand Your Calculator’s Charging Requirements
The TI-84 Plus CE uses a rechargeable lithium-ion battery, which requires a specific type of charger. I made sure to check the voltage and connector type recommended by Texas Instruments—typically a 5V USB charger with a micro-USB or USB-C port depending on your model. Using the wrong charger can damage your battery or slow down charging.
2. Choose Between Official vs. Third-Party Chargers
At first, I considered buying the official TI charger for peace of mind. The official charger guarantees compatibility and safety but can be pricier. On the other hand, many third-party chargers offer good quality at a lower price. When I went with a third-party option, I looked for well-reviewed brands that explicitly stated compatibility with the TI-84 Plus CE.
3. Look for Fast Charging Features
Since I often use my calculator for long study sessions, I wanted a charger that could quickly recharge the battery. Some chargers offer fast charging technology that cuts down wait time. I checked product details for output ratings like 5V/2A or higher to ensure faster charging.
4. Portability and Cable Length
If you’re like me and carry your calculator between home, school, or work, portability matters. I preferred a compact charger that’s easy to pack and a cable long enough to reach power outlets comfortably without being cumbersome.
5. Safety Features Are a Must
I always prioritize safety when buying electronics. Look for chargers with built-in protections against overcharging, overheating, and short circuits. These features help extend your calculator’s battery life and prevent accidents.
6. Read Customer Reviews and Ratings
Before making my final decision, I spent time reading user reviews to see how well the charger performed in real life. Reviews often reveal issues like poor build quality or charging inconsistencies that product descriptions don’t mention.
7. Price vs. Value
While I didn’t want to overspend, I avoided the cheapest options that seemed unreliable. Instead, I aimed for a charger that balances quality and affordability, ensuring good value for my money.
